Tech Mahindra Forays In Cloud Services

by Biztech2.com Staff 16th March, 2011 in Cloud Computing

   

Tech Mahindra, the provider of solutions and services to the telecommunication industry has announced inauguration of a cloud competency lab at its Hinjewadi facility in Pune, India. Tech Mahindra’s strategic intent is to be cloud advisor, enabler and manager in cloud services ecosystem. This will enable its clients to choose from best-of-breed technologies and integrate them to meet their business objective of growing revenue on cloud based services.

As part of its service, the lab will provide playground for its customers to conduct proof of concepts before deploying large scale environments and to assess current environment such as infrastructure and application foot print to deliver a clear outcome-based "Cloud Adoption Roadmap" report.  Tech Mahindra's partners can access the lab globally to build solutions. A dedicated research team consisting of domain experts in Billing, CRM, Portal, Business Intelligence and Infrastructure technologies with dedicated product managers is developing various service offerings using this lab as key platform enabler. The cloud competency lab will further help customers experience Tech Mahindra’s products and cloud solutions which will help them make informed decisions in applying these to support their business strategies.

"Cloud services are playing a significant role in transforming businesses worldwide and our focus is to build cloud specific solutions, invest in skills and infrastructure for labs and build professional services strength by up-skilling our talent pool. Tech Mahindra's vision on Cloud services is to be a preferred services partner for Telecom/Communications Services Provider (TSP) by leveraging our deep experience in telecom IT systems and strategic partner relationships. This will help our customers realise the value proposition of Tech Mahindra's Cloud Services landscape and further leverage partner ecosystem to create specific solutions," said Vikas Gupta, Vice President, Cloud Competency, Tech Mahindra.
